A Soiree For Skeptics

by Wrekonize on August 30, 2010

When i was signed to Southbeat I recorded some 50 odd records for what i later shaved down to 14 for my first official album. With the fall of the label, my album never saw the light of day besides the few hundred people that got the leak offline. I always felt it was for a reason and after picking up new tools of the trade over the years i’ve realized that i feel the music i’m making now is much more representative of who I am. So, while on break from working on projects with ¡MAYDAY, I took some of the early material (where I was exploring putting more singing into the music) and recorded some newer tracks for what would become “A Soiree For Skeptics”. It’s a 20 track 61 minute journey through the last few years of my music and outlook on the world and life and all that good shit. It features a few songs that date back a couple years at least and a few songs that are barely a month or two old. I feel the album ranges from my roots in the hip hop I first started making to the more diverse sounds i’ve been exploring with ¡MAYDAY!. Over the last few years I’ve dropped a few free mixtapes and given away the album that got shelved.
